Beschreibung:

MATISSE, Henri (1869-1954). Jazz . New York: George Braziller, [1983]. 2°, 20 coloured plates, most double-page. Unbound as issued in original decorative wrappers, original cloth-backed box with paper label (box slightly soiled). Facsimile of the original editon of 250 copies published by Tériade for Éditions Verve, 30 September 1947. -- GUICHARD-MEILI, Jean. Les gouaches découpées de Henri Matisse . Paris: Fernand Hazan, [1983]. 4°, 51 coloured plates, several folding. Original white cloth (soiled, rear inner hinges slightly split).
MATISSE, Henri (1869-1954). Jazz . New York: George Braziller, [1983]. 2°, 20 coloured plates, most double-page. Unbound as issued in original decorative wrappers, original cloth-backed box with paper label (box slightly soiled). Facsimile of the original editon of 250 copies published by Tériade for Éditions Verve, 30 September 1947. -- GUICHARD-MEILI, Jean. Les gouaches découpées de Henri Matisse . Paris: Fernand Hazan, [1983]. 4°, 51 coloured plates, several folding. Original white cloth (soiled, rear inner hinges slightly split). PICASSO, Pablo (1881-1973). Toros y Toreros, texte de Luis Miguel Dominguin . Paris: Cercle d'Art, 1961. 2°, lithographic plates after Picasso, many coloured. Original pictorial cloth (spine and extremities faded). -- PICASSO, P. Les Déjeuners, texte de Douglas Cooper . Paris: Cercle d'Art, 1962. 2°, lithographic plates after Picasso, many coloured. Original pictorial cloth (slightly soiled). DUBUFFET, Jean (1901-1985). La Fleur de Barbe . [Paris]: l'imprimerie Duval, March 1960. 2°, 4 phototype plates after Dubuffet. (Title a little soiled, slight staining to margin of sectional title.) Unbound as issued in original wrappers (spine worn). Number 246 of 500 copies on velin d'arches. NICOLSON, Benedict. Caravaggism in Europe , enlarged by Luisa Vertova. Torino: Umberto Allemandi, 1990. 3 vols., 4°, 2 vols. of plates, original cloth, dust-jackets, original slipcase. Second edition. First published in 1979 as The International Caravaggesque Movement . (8)
